**systemd Service Implementation:**
- Created tractatus-dev.service for development environment
- Created tractatus-prod.service for production environment
- Added install-systemd.sh script for easy deployment
- Security hardening: NoNewPrivileges, PrivateTmp, ProtectSystem
- Resource limits: 1GB dev, 2GB prod memory limits
- Proper logging integration with journalctl
- Automatic restart on failure (RestartSec=10)

**Why systemd over pm2:**
1. Native Linux integration, no additional dependencies
2. Better OS-level security controls (ProtectSystem, ProtectHome)
3. Superior logging with journalctl integration
4. Standard across Linux distributions
5. More robust process management for production

6. Known Issues / Challenges

🐛 Issues Identified During Deployment

Issue 1: Production Dependencies Missing RESOLVED

  • Problem: stripe package not installed on production
  • Solution: Ran npm install stripe on production server
  • Prevention: Update deployment script to include npm install step

Issue 2: Logger Utility Missing RESOLVED

  • Problem: src/utils/logger.js didn't exist on production
  • Solution: Created simple console-based logger utility
  • Note: koha.service.js also includes inline logger for redundancy
  • Prevention: Add logger utility to deployment checklist

Issue 3: Routes Not Registered RESOLVED

  • Problem: src/routes/index.js not updated with Koha routes
  • Solution: Deployed updated index.js with Koha route registration
  • Prevention: Ensure route registration in initial backend deployment

Issue 4: Directory Permissions RESOLVED

  • Problem: /public/koha/ directory had restrictive permissions (700)
  • Solution: Changed to 755: chmod 755 /var/www/tractatus/public/koha
  • Prevention: Include permission fix in deployment script

Issue 5: PM2 Process Management UNDERSTOOD

  • Problem: Initially tried systemctl (doesn't exist)
  • Solution: Identified production uses PM2 process manager
  • Resolution: Used pm2 restart tractatus for server restart
  • Note: Document PM2 usage in deployment guide

🔐 Security Recommendations

Before Going Live:

  1. Stripe webhook signature verification (implemented)
  2. HTTPS enforced (nginx configuration)
  3. Environment variables secured (not in git)
  4. ⚠️ Rate limiting (not yet implemented on /api/koha/checkout)
  5. ⚠️ CAPTCHA (not implemented - consider for spam prevention)
  6. ⚠️ CSP headers (not verified)
  7. ⚠️ Input sanitization audit (should verify)

Action Items:

  • Add rate limiting middleware to Koha routes
  • Consider CAPTCHA on donation form (hCaptcha or reCAPTCHA)
  • Audit input validation in koha.controller.js
  • Verify CSP headers in nginx configuration
